Who was the first Prime Minister of UK?
Modern historians generally consider Sir Robert Walpole, who led the government of Great Britain for over twenty years from 1721, as the first prime minister. Walpole is also the longest-serving British prime minister by this definition.
Who was the only Welsh born Prime Minister?
David Lloyd George was one of the 20th century’s most famous radicals. He was the first and only Welshman to hold the office of Prime Minister.
Has the UK ever had an Irish Prime Minister?
Lord Palmerston was the only Irish peer to serve as Prime Minister, thus leading from the House of Commons.

Who is the leader of the Welsh Government?
The First Minister of Wales (Welsh: Prif Weinidog Cymru) is the leader of the Welsh Government, Wales’ devolved administration.
How are members of the Welsh Cabinet appointed?
Members of the Welsh Cabinet and junior ministers of the Welsh Government, as well as law officers, are appointed by the first minister. As head of the Welsh Government, the first minister is directly accountable to the Senedd for their actions and the actions of the Welsh Government.
